type PageRule ¶
type PageRule struct { // Identifier ID string `json:"id,required"` // The set of actions to perform if the targets of this rule match the request. // Actions can redirect to another URL or override settings, but not both. Actions []Route `json:"actions,required"` // The timestamp of when the Page Rule was created. CreatedOn time.Time `json:"created_on,required" format:"date-time"` // The timestamp of when the Page Rule was last modified. ModifiedOn time.Time `json:"modified_on,required" format:"date-time"` // The priority of the rule, used to define which Page Rule is processed over // another. A higher number indicates a higher priority. For example, if you have a // catch-all Page Rule (rule A: `/images/*`) but want a more specific Page Rule to // take precedence (rule B: `/images/special/*`), specify a higher priority for // rule B so it overrides rule A. Priority int64 `json:"priority,required"` // The status of the Page Rule. Status PageRuleStatus `json:"status,required"` // The rule targets to evaluate on each request. Targets []Target `json:"targets,required"` JSON pageRuleJSON `json:"-"` }

type PageruleService ¶
type PageruleService struct { Options []option.RequestOption Settings *SettingService }
PageruleService contains methods and other services that help with interacting with the cloudflare API. Note, unlike clients, this service does not read variables from the environment automatically. You should not instantiate this service directly, and instead use the NewPageruleService method instead.
func NewPageruleService ¶
func NewPageruleService(opts ...option.RequestOption) (r *PageruleService)
NewPageruleService generates a new service that applies the given options to each request. These options are applied after the parent client's options (if there is one), and before any request-specific options.
func (*PageruleService) Delete ¶
func (r *PageruleService) Delete(ctx context.Context, pageruleID string, body PageruleDeleteParams, opts ...option.RequestOption) (res *PageruleDeleteResponse, err error)
Deletes an existing Page Rule.
func (*PageruleService) Edit ¶
func (r *PageruleService) Edit(ctx context.Context, pageruleID string, params PageruleEditParams, opts ...option.RequestOption) (res *PageruleEditResponseUnion, err error)
Updates one or more fields of an existing Page Rule.
func (*PageruleService) Get ¶
func (r *PageruleService) Get(ctx context.Context, pageruleID string, query PageruleGetParams, opts ...option.RequestOption) (res *PageruleGetResponseUnion, err error)
Fetches the details of a Page Rule.
func (*PageruleService) List ¶
func (r *PageruleService) List(ctx context.Context, params PageruleListParams, opts ...option.RequestOption) (res *[]PageRule, err error)
Fetches Page Rules in a zone.
func (*PageruleService) New ¶
func (r *PageruleService) New(ctx context.Context, params PageruleNewParams, opts ...option.RequestOption) (res *PageruleNewResponseUnion, err error)
Creates a new Page Rule.
func (*PageruleService) Update ¶
func (r *PageruleService) Update(ctx context.Context, pageruleID string, params PageruleUpdateParams, opts ...option.RequestOption) (res *PageruleUpdateResponseUnion, err error)
Replaces the configuration of an existing Page Rule. The configuration of the updated Page Rule will exactly match the data passed in the API request.

type TargetConstraint ¶
type TargetConstraint struct { // The matches operator can use asterisks and pipes as wildcard and 'or' operators. Operator TargetConstraintOperator `json:"operator,required"` // The URL pattern to match against the current request. The pattern may contain up // to four asterisks ('\*') as placeholders. Value string `json:"value,required"` JSON targetConstraintJSON `json:"-"` }
String constraint.
func (*TargetConstraint) UnmarshalJSON ¶
func (r *TargetConstraint) UnmarshalJSON(data []byte) (err error)
type TargetConstraintOperator ¶
type TargetConstraintOperator string
The matches operator can use asterisks and pipes as wildcard and 'or' operators.
const ( TargetConstraintOperatorMatches TargetConstraintOperator = "matches" TargetConstraintOperatorContains TargetConstraintOperator = "contains" TargetConstraintOperatorEquals TargetConstraintOperator = "equals" TargetConstraintOperatorNotEqual TargetConstraintOperator = "not_equal" TargetConstraintOperatorNotContain TargetConstraintOperator = "not_contain" )
func (TargetConstraintOperator) IsKnown ¶
func (r TargetConstraintOperator) IsKnown() bool
